When the Château de Bridoré steals the spotlight...


In early March 2025, the Château de Bridoré buzzed with activity as France 3 set up its cameras. The renowned French host and musician André Manoukian honored the medieval fortress with his presence to film a new episode of the TV show “Château!”, which highlights hidden treasures of French heritage.

“Château!”, broadcasted on France 3 and presented by André Manoukian, takes viewers on a journey through France’s most beautiful castles, particularly in the Centre-Val de Loire region.





Each Sunday at 12:55 p.m., André Manoukian, as an artist and passionate cultural advocate, dives into the rich history, architecture, and music of these heritage gems, offering a fully immersive experience.

Immersive Filming Experience


Since 2023, the Château de Bridoré has been a proud member of the Loire Valley Castles Association. Its medieval past made it an unmissable stop for the show’s production team.


The shoot brought to light some of unique features offered by the Château located next to Tours and Loches in France.

  • Exploration of 16th-century caponiers currently under restoration


  • Discovery of a rare medieval steam bath heating system (hypocaust), unique in the Touraine region


  • A quirky historical anecdote shared by owner Pierre-Alexandre Mouveau: “Did you know a duel between two local lords ended... in the grain silo?”
